The Architecture of Resilience

Modern hybrid systems aren't just panels + batteries. They're intelligent ecosystems where:

  • AI-driven controllers predict consumption 72 hours ahead
  • Phase-balancing technology prevents grid feedback surges
  • Modular storage allows incremental capacity upgrades

3 Strategic Insights for Global Solar Adopters

Insight #1: Thermal Management is the Silent Game-Changer

Battery degradation accelerates by 18% per 10°C above optimal temps. Our Nigeria-tested cooling protocols now prevent this across European deployments.

Insight #2: Software Eats the Solar World

Algorithms now contribute 40% of storage ROI through value-stacking – a fact overlooked by hardware-focused providers.

Insight #3: Hybridization Beats Scale

A 500kW system with storage outperforms 1MW standalone solar in net profitability, according to NREL's LCOE models.
